How much do remote legal assistant secretary jobs pay per year?

As of Jul 21, 2026, the average yearly pay for remote legal assistant secretary in the United States is $53,278.00,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$44,000.00 and $60,000.00 per year,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What are remote legal assistant secretaries?

Remote legal assistant secretaries are administrative professionals who support lawyers and legal teams from a remote location, often working from home. Their responsibilities typically include drafting legal documents, managing schedules, organizing files, conducting legal research, and communicating with clients. By working remotely, they use digital tools and secure communication platforms to perform their tasks efficiently. This role is ideal for individuals who have strong organizational skills, attention to detail, and proficiency with legal and office software.

What are some common challenges faced by Remote Legal Assistant Secretaries, and how can they be effectively managed?

Remote Legal Assistant Secretaries often encounter challenges such as coordinating schedules across time zones, ensuring secure handling of sensitive documents, and maintaining clear communication with attorneys and clients. To manage these challenges, it’s important to use secure digital tools for document management, establish clear protocols for virtual communication, and stay organized with shared calendars and task lists. Proactively checking in with team members and setting clear expectations for response times can also help ensure smooth workflow and minimize misunderstandings.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a Remote Legal Assistant Secretary,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Remote Legal Assistant Secretary, you need strong organizational skills, attention to detail, and a solid understanding of legal terminology and procedures, typically supported by a legal studies certificate or relevant administrative experience. Familiarity with legal practice management software, document management systems, and virtual communication platforms is essential. Excellent written communication, time management, and discretion in handling sensitive information are standout soft skills. These abilities ensure efficient support for legal professionals, maintain confidentiality, and enable smooth remote operations in a legal environment.

Job description

Position: Remote Legal Assistant
Job Summary:
CDF is seeking an experienced Legal Assistant to join our support team.
This position represents a great opportunity for a detail-oriented person to be the point person on managing litigation cases for their attorneys from start to conclusion. The ideal candidate must possess exceptional word processing skills, have strong technical, written and verbal communication skills and be able to prioritize competing tasks with poise and professionalism. The Legal Assistant will provide overflow support to all five of CDF's offices. This position reports to the Director of Legal Operations and the Irvine Office Managing Partner.
Position Type / Expected Hours of Work
This is a full-time, remote position. Days and hours are Monday through Friday 8:00 a.m. to 5:00 p.m. Although working remotely, candidates must live near one of our five offices (OC, LA, SD, SF, SAC) in California. Preferably near LA or OC, which is ideal for onsite training for 30 days.
Qualifications:
  • Must have 5+ years of experience as a Litigation/Legal Assistant in a litigation environment. Labor and employment experience is preferred but not required for the right candidate.
  • Must have experience in calendaring, researching court rules/local rules/judge's rules, and ability to cross-check calendaring using software such as eDockets, Milana or Compulaw.
  • Must have experience with eFiling in both State and Federal courts; including but not limited to creating tables of authority, bookmarking exhibits, redacting and Bates stamping.
  • Position requires critical thinking skills, attention to detail, proof-reading skills, and ability to multi-task.
  • Must be proficient in MS Office 365 Programs (Word, Excel, and Outlook).
  • Duties also include the following tasks: travel arrangements, expense reports, entering attorney timesheets, and other administrative type duties as assigned.

Education:
  • High school diploma or equivalent required. Some college coursework is preferred.
